- Improve error messages
- Include Transaction ID in the errors and debug trace
Version history
2.12.0Bamboo Server 7.0.6 - 8.2.22024-02-13Improved error messages Version 2.12.0 • Released 2024-02-13 • Supported By 42Crunch Support • Free • Commercial - no charge2.11.0Bamboo Server 7.0.6 - 8.2.22023-05-12Extend JSON report with additional information Version 2.11.0 • Released 2023-05-12 • Supported By 42Crunch Support • Free • Commercial - no chargeJSON report now includes additional items:
- List of deleted APIs
- Information about collection used for discovered APIs
2.10.0Bamboo Server 7.0.6 - 8.2.22023-03-02Update to API Tagging and support for additional flags Version 2.10.0 • Released 2023-03-02 • Supported By 42Crunch Support • Free • Commercial - no charge- New tags can be created by the plugin if the tags category permits user to do it
- Add number of flags to make plugin ignore failures or network errors or to make it to check just the SQG failures
2.8.1Bamboo Server 7.0.6 - 8.2.22022-12-11Support for API tagging and JSON Report - Adds support for tagging of a newly created APIs
- Adds support for writing report file in JSON format with details of files checked, failures, etc.
2.6.0Bamboo Server 7.0.6 - 8.2.22022-05-19Compatibitly update for newest Bamboo version - Updated for compatibility with Bamboo 8.2.2
- Error messages modified to include Transaction ID to aid with resolving server-side issues
2.4.0Bamboo Server 7.0.6 - 8.0.132022-02-14Support for SQGs and building of tags and PRs This release adds support for checking of Security Quality Gates and support for running builds on tags and PRs.
2.2.0Bamboo Server 7.0.6 - 8.0.132021-11-09Compatibility with newest version of Bamboo Release for compatibility with 7.0.5 to 8.0.4 versions of Bamboo
2.1.0Bamboo Server 6.8.0 - 7.2.102021-10-12New audit mini-report on job result summary page - Added new mini-report that displays names of files processed by Security Audit along with pass/fail icon and the link to open full audit report at 42Crunch platform.
2.0.3Bamboo Server 6.8.0 - 7.2.102021-05-21Repository based collection management. New 42c-conf.yaml format - Config option to specify collection name has been removed. Instead a source control "repository name" and "branch name" are used to create or find a relevant collection. The variables 'bamboo.planRepository.repositoryUrl' and 'bamboo.planRepository.branchName' are used to get repository name and branch name during the build.
- New option to automatically share any new API collections that the task creates.
- Format of "42c-conf.yaml" has been changed to allow specifying configuration on per-branch basis.
1.6.5Bamboo Server 6.8.0 - 7.2.102021-03-03Authentication mechanism changed, added platformUrl support - This update introduces a breaking change in the way the API Token is configured. In previous versions shared credentials have been used and this update changes to use Bamboo global variable instead. Please make sure to update your API Token configuration to reflect the change.
- Configuration option for setting platform URL has been added.
- Configuration option for setting trace level has been added.
- Issue where the app would fail to run on Bamboo remote agent has been resolved.
1.4.0Bamboo Server 6.8.0 - 7.2.102021-02-01Adds configuration option to set Platform URL Adds configuration option to set Platform URL
Also this build includes fixes and improvements in handling OpenAPI file with external $ref's.
1.3.0Bamboo Server 6.8.0 - 7.0.62020-06-17Misc internal improvements * Misc refactoring in the codebase
1.2.0Bamboo Server 6.8.0 - 7.0.62020-06-08Bugfix release Fix for the issue where local references where overwritten prior to sending the file for audit.
Fix for the issue where broken yaml/json files would cause uncaught exception.
1.1.0Bamboo Server 6.8.0 - 7.0.62020-05-27Support for mutli-file OpenAPI files This release adds support for multi-file OpenAPI files (these files contain references to external files, therefore single API definition can be maid up from multiple files).
1.0.0Bamboo Server 6.8.0 - 7.0.62020-05-27Security Audit (SAST static analysis) of OpenAPI / Swagger files No release notes.